> Hello Dave,
>
> This patch adds some output to the vtop command on s390x. Like on x86 we
> now
> print information for the page table walk:
>
>  * "Region-First-Table Entry" (RFTE)
>  * "Region-Second-Table Entry" (RSTE)
>  * "Region-Third-Table Entry" (RTTE)
>  * "Segment Table Entry" (STE)
>  * "Page Table Entry" (PTE)
>  * "Read address of page" (PAGE)
>
> Depending on the size of the address space the page tables can start at
> different levels.
>
> Example for three level page tables:
>
>   crash> vtop 3ff8000c000
>   VIRTUAL           PHYSICAL
>   3ff8000c000       2e3832000
>
>   PAGE DIRECTORY: 0000000000aaa000
>    RTTE: 0000000000aadff8 => 00000002e3c00007
>     STE: 00000002e3c00000 => 00000002e3df7000
>     PTE: 00000002e3df7060 => 00000002e383203d
>    PAGE: 00000002e3832000
>
>         PAGE        PHYSICAL      MAPPING       INDEX CNT FLAGS
>   3d10b8e0c80      2e3832000                0        0  1 7fffc0000000000
>
> The first entry e.g. "PTE: 00000002e3df7060" is the physical address
> of the entry in the table. The second, e.g. "=> 00000002e383203d" is the
> content of the entry itself (address and flags).
